•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• 27
  • 3
  • 2
  • Tagged with
  • 32
  • 32
  • 14
  • 14
  • 8
  • 7
  • 7
  • 6
  • 6
  • 6
  • 6
  • 6
  • 5
  • 5
  • 5
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
31

Une approche dirigée par les modèles pour le développement de tests pour systèmes avioniques embarqués / A model-driven development of tests for avionics embedded systems

Guduvan, Alexandru-Robert-Ciprian 18 April 2013 (has links)
Le développement de tests pour les systèmes d’avioniques met en jeu une multiplicité de langages de test propriétaires, sans aucun standard émergent.Les fournisseurs de solutions de test doivent tenir compte des habitudes des différents clients, tandis que les échanges de tests entre les avionneurs et leurs équipementiers / systémiers sont entravés. Nous proposons une approche dirigée par les modèles pour s’attaquer à ces problèmes: des modèles de test sont développés et maintenus à la place du code, avec des transformations modèle-vers-code vers des langages de test cibles. Cette thèse présente trois contributions dans ce sens. La première consiste en l’analyse de quatre langages de test propriétaires actuellement déployés. Elle nous a permis d’identifier les concepts spécifiques au domaine, les meilleures pratiques,ainsi que les pièges à éviter. La deuxième contribution est la définition d’un méta-modèle en EMF Ecore, qui intègre tous les concepts identifiés et leurs relations. Le méta-modèle est la base pour construire des éditeurs de modèles de test et des motifs de génération de code. Notre troisième contribution est un d´démonstrateur de la façon dont ces technologies sont utilisées pour l’élaboration des tests. Il comprend des éditeurs personnalisables graphiques et textuels pour des modèles de test, ainsi que des transformations basées-motifs vers un langage du test exécutable sur une plateforme de test réelle. / The development of tests for avionics systems involves a multiplicity of in-house test languages, with no standard emerging. Test solution providers have to accommodate the habits of different clients, while the exchange of tests between aircraft manufacturers and their equipment/system providers is hindered. We propose a model-driven approach to tackle these problems: test models would be developed and maintained in place of code, with model-to-code transformations towards target test languages. This thesis presents three contributions in this direction. The first one consists in the analysis of four proprietary test languages currently deployed. It allowed us to identify the domain-specific concepts, best practices, as well as pitfalls to avoid. The second contribution is the definition of a meta-model in EMF Ecore that integrates all identified concepts and their relations. The meta-model is the basis for building test model editors and code generation templates. Our third contribution is a demonstrator of how these technologies are used for test development. It includes customizable graphical and textual editors for test models, together with template-based transformations towards a test language executable on top of a real test platform.
32

Intégration des méthodes de sensibilité d'ordre élevé dans un processus de conception optimale des turbomachines : développement de méta-modèles

Zhang, Zebin 15 December 2014 (has links)
La conception optimale de turbomachines repose usuellement sur des méthodes itératives avec des évaluations soit expérimentales, soit numériques qui peuvent conduire à des coûts élevés en raison des nombreuses manipulations ou de l’utilisation intensive de CPU. Afin de limiter ces coûts et de raccourcir les temps de développement, le présent travail propose d’intégrer une méthode de paramétrisation et de métamodélisation dans un cycle de conception d’une turbomachine axiale basse vitesse. La paramétrisation, réalisée par l’étude de sensibilité d’ordre élevé des équations de Navier-Stokes, permet de construire une base de données paramétrée qui contient non seulement les résultats d’évaluations, mais aussi les dérivées simples et les dérivées croisées des objectifs en fonction des paramètres. La plus grande quantité d’informations apportée par les dérivées est avantageusement utilisée lors de la construction de métamodèles, en particulier avec une méthode de Co-Krigeage employée pour coupler plusieurs bases de données. L’intérêt économique de la méthode par rapport à une méthode classique sans dérivée réside dans l’utilisation d’un nombre réduit de points d’évaluation. Lorsque ce nombre de points est véritablement faible, il peut arriver qu’une seule valeur de référence soit disponible pour une ou plusieurs dimensions, et nécessite une hypothèse de répartition d’erreur. Pour ces dimensions, le Co-Krigeage fonctionne comme une extrapolation de Taylor à partir d’un point et de ses dérivées. Cette approche a été expérimentée avec la construction d’un méta-modèle pour une hélice présentant un moyeu conique. La méthodologie fait appel à un couplage de bases de données issues de deux géométries et deux points de fonctionnement. La précision de la surface de réponse a permis de conduire une optimisation avec un algorithme génétique NSGA-2, et les deux optima sélectionnés répondent pour l’un à une maximisation du rendement, et pour l’autre à un élargissement de la plage de fonctionnement. Les résultats d’optimisation sont finalement validés par des simulations numériques supplémentaires. / The turbomachinery optimal design usually relies on some iterative methods with either experimental or numerical evaluations that can lead to high cost due to numerous manipulations and intensive usage of CPU. In order to limit the cost and shorten the development time, the present thesis work proposes to integrate a parameterization method and the meta-modelization method in an optimal design cycle of an axial low speed turbomachine. The parameterization, realized by the high order sensitivity study of Navier-Stokes equations, allows to construct a parameterized database that contains not only the evaluations results, but also the simple and cross derivatives of objectives as a function of parameters. Enriched information brought by the derivatives are utilized during the meta-model construction, particularly by the Co-Kriging method employed to couple several databases. Compared to classical methods that are without derivatives, the economic benefit of the proposed method lies in the use of less reference points. Provided the number of reference points is small, chances are a unique point presenting at one or several dimensions, which requires a hypothesis on the error distribution. For those dimensions, the Co-Kriging works like a Taylor extrapolation from the reference point making the most of its derivatives. This approach has been experimented on the construction of a meta-model for a conic hub fan. The methodology recalls the coupling of databases based on two fan geometries and two operating points. The precision of the meta-model allows to perform an optimization with help of NSGA-2, one of the optima selected reaches the maximum efficiency, and another covers a large operating range. The optimization results are eventually validated by further numerical simulations.

Page generated in 0.2997 seconds